Overview

Pellston Regional Airport (PLN) is a hidden gem located in Pellston, Michigan, serving as the northernmost commercial airport in the Lower Peninsula. Perfectly positioned for both business and leisure travelers, it provides easy access to Michigan’s Upper Peninsula and popular destinations like Mackinac Island, Petoskey, and Charlevoix.

The airport features well-maintained 6,500 and 5,400 foot runways, accommodating Delta regional jets and a variety of general aviation aircraft. Its modern terminal offers two jetways along with dozens of GA parking. Pellston Regional Airport’s strategic location is ideal for handling the seasonal influx of tourists, with the surrounding area attracting visitors year-round for outdoor activities and events.
